1. The order dated 06th December, 2025 reads as under:-
“Issue notice upon the respondent no.3 and 4 through speed post as well as under ordinary process, for which requisites etc. must be filed by next Wednesday i.e., 10.12.2025, failing which, the present writ petition shall stand dismissed without further reference to the Bench.
2. Till further order, there shall be no construction over the plot in question.
3. In view of the above order, learned counsel for the petitioner wants to withdraw I.A. No. 15371 of 2025 seeking stay of the operation of the Building Permit (Annexure-3).
4. Accordingly, I.A. No. 15371 of 2025 is dismissed as withdrawn.
5. Put up this case on 15.01.2026.”
2. The order dated 19th December, 2025 reads as under:-
“Heard Mr. Sumeet Gadodia, learned counsel for the petitioners, Mr.
L.C.N. Sahdeo, learned counsel for the Respondent Nos.1 and 2- Ranchi Municipal Corporation and Mr. Rajendra Krishna, learned counsel for the Respondent Nos.3 and 4.
2. This case was heard for the first time on 06.12.2025 and notices were issued to the Respondent No.3 and 4 and the Coordinate Bench (Hon’ble Mr. Justice Rajesh Kumar) directed that till further order, there shall be no construction over the plot in question.
The petitioners had also withdrawn I.A. No.15371 of 2025 seeking stay of the operation of the Building Permit (Annexure-3).
3. This case was placed on 16.12.025 before this Court when the Respondent Nos.3 and 4 had filed Interlocutory Application being I.A. No.16897 of 2025 for vacating stay order and this case was mentioned before this Court. Then the matter was placed before this Court on 16.12.2025 as the Co-ordinate Bench (Hon’ble Mr. Justice Rajesh Kumar) was not available for the last few days and the case has been heard in the light of administrative instruction of Hon’ble the Chief Justice by which this Court has been authorized to hear the urgent matters of the roster of the Co-ordinate Bench (Hon’ble Mr. Justice Rajesh Kumar).
4. I.A. No.16897 of 2025 has been filed on behalf of the Respondent No. 4 on 15.12.2025 for vacating the interim order dated 06.12.2025 passed in W.P. (C) No.6864 of 2025 by the Co-ordinate Bench.
5. The petitioners have also filed reply to the I.A. No.16897 of 2025 on
18.12.2025.
6. Learned counsel for the Respondent No.3 and 4 mainly has contended that the order dated 06.12.2025 has been passed in absence of Respondent No.3 and 4 by which the construction over the plot in question has been stayed. It is further submitted that Ranchi Municipal Corporation has already instituted a complaint filed by some of the residents and U.C Case has been registered. It is further submitted that there are twelve (12) land owners who have not been made parties in this writ petition. It is also contended that this writ petition is also not maintainable. It is submitted that building plan has already been approved on 06.05.2024 (i.e. Annexure-3 of the writ petition) by the Respondents-RMC. It is further contended that only four persons have filed this instant writ petition and also raised number of contentions. It is submitted that even the R.M.C has issued notice to the Respondents vie letter No.544 dated 16.10.2025 (marked as Annexure-1-A/1) in this Interlocutory Application and which has been suppressed by the petitioners while filing this writ petition. 7.
